Femoral Fracture due to Falls in an Elderly with Chronic Diseases
Cho Choo-Yon

Cho Yong-Jin
Abstract
The population of the elderly people is increasing gradually and their falls has been a significant clinical problem. Fall-induced injuries are easy to cause fractures, long-term pain, functional impairments, disabilities, and eventually lead to the death. They need multi-factorial and single interventions such as muscle strengthening exercises, balance trainings, life style modifications, adjustments of medication regimens (especially psychiatric medication), the use of assist devices (cane, walker and etc.), vitamin D and calcium supplements intake, and vision corrections (for example, the cataract surgery) to correct risk factors and prevent falls. We should assess the elderly people for falls and risk factors once a year and also apply better and more appropriate interventions.
